Tool use in left brain damage and Alzheimer's disease: What about function and manipulation knowledge?
Christophe Jarry1, François Osiurak2,3, Jérémy Besnard1
1Laboratory of Psychology LPPL (EA 4638), University of Angers, France.
Tool use disorders involve knowledge retrieval issues. Alzheimer disease (AD) patients struggled with manipulation and function knowledge, while left-brain-damaged (LBD) patients showed impaired tool use.

Background:
- Tool use disorders are often linked to difficulties in accessing functional and manipulation knowledge.
- Understanding the cognitive underpinnings of tool use is crucial for diagnosing and treating related disorders.
Purpose of the Study:
- To investigate the relationship between real tool use (RTU), functional association (FA), and manipulation knowledge (Gesture Recognition, GR) in patients with left-brain damage (LBD) and Alzheimer disease (AD).
- To determine the specific deficits in knowledge retrieval associated with different neurological conditions and their impact on actual tool use.
Main Methods:
- Assessed RTU, FA, and GR in 17 LBD patients and 14 AD patients.
- Compared performance across patient groups to identify specific cognitive deficits.
Main Results:
- LBD patients demonstrated the expected deficit in RTU but performed adequately on FA and GR tasks.
- AD patients exhibited deficits in GR and FA, yet their tool use skills remained preserved.
- These results challenge the direct causal link between function/manipulation knowledge and the execution of tool use.
Conclusions:
- The study suggests that deficits in functional and manipulation knowledge may not directly impair real tool use in all neurological conditions.
- Alzheimer disease patients' preserved tool use despite deficits in specific knowledge types warrants further investigation.
- Findings necessitate a re-evaluation of the cognitive models explaining tool use disorders.
